WE-PD Series Magnetically Shielded Wire Wound Chokes


Wurth WE-PD wirewound surface mount inductor is magnetically shielded resulting in a low leakage field. These power inductors have high storage capacity and high current loading. Recommended solder profile: Reflow. Operating temperature -40 to +125°C.

Applications


Switching regulators with low operating voltages

Integrated DC-DC converters

Switching regulators with high efficiency (>86%)

Graphic cards
